RENO, Nev. – Pet parents now have a new store in town to find everything they need to spoil their furry friends. Bone-ito opened today in The Village at Rancharrah. The new shop features premium pet products, self-wash services and customized experiences to pamper each and every pet that walks through the door.
“Understanding the important role pets play in our lives is the framework for our business,” said Staci Alonso, owner of Bone-ito and founder of Noah’s Animal House, a full-service pet facility located on the grounds of a domestic violence shelter. “The bones of Bone-ito are built on that same ‘love unconditionally’ purpose through our commitment to raising awareness and funds for Noah’s.”
As part of the store’s foundation, Bone-ito will support Noah’s Animal House’s mission to remove the “no pets allowed” barrier at women’s shelters for the courageous survivors looking to get back on their feet with their pet by their side. A donation will be made to Noah’s with every purchase.
“We believe in the power of healing that pets provide, especially during times of crisis and Bone-ito will offer fun ways for pet parents to show gratitude for that unconditional love,” said Alonso, “Any shopper that leaves with a Bone-ito bag in hand, will have just helped a pet staying at Noah’s Reno in partnership with Domestic Violence Resource Center, Step2, Eddy House and Awaken.”
As of this month, Noah’s Animal House has helped 2,021 pets from 34 states.
